Thankyou . And what should I use for thr headlights?
I'm a fan of regular polishing when they fade.
Until then, there's lots of options. Check out the coating by Optimum Polymer Technologies. I trust anything formulated by Dr. David Ghodoussi, owner and head chemist for Optimum Polymer Technologies.
